Stantec has an active Community Development Group that provides services to the land development industry in Waterloo Region and surrounding areas. As the successful candidate, you will be primarily responsible for inspection and contract administration for our land development projects. Local (regional) travel is expected. Your duties will include:

 

  • Inspection of construction activities, layout and designs.
  • Preparing and assisting with the preparation of contract correspondence, documents and specifications. 
  • General site contract administration duties, including daily and weekly reports, quantities and compiling provisional payment certificates.
  • Coordinating with Stantec design teams, contractors, developers and the general public
  • Assisting with the coordination and work of projects relating to Community Development services.
  • Field identification of maintenance deficiencies, coordinate the repairs and city approvals.
  • Conducting and assisting with site surveying and/or inspection activities
